Reviewed on 6/27/2010. On tap at the brewpub. Pours a clear burnt orange with a white head. Aroma of sweet malt, light fruits, and bready malt. Flavor of sweet malt, bready malts. Not too sweet although sweet malt is the dominant flavor. Very drinkable and tasty. A surprise winner for me.

was served a glass at the brewery, light amber with no head.
the aroma was malty, hint of noble hops, hint of carmelized malt.
the flavor is malty, good hop flavor, carmelized malt, minerallity lingering.
good session beer goes down easy very enjoyable while sitting on the deck.

A very nice beer. 4.2 % ABV. Pours a cooper to brown color, nice, carries a smallish head with nice lace sticking to the glass. Nose shows off the malt, flavor is malty sweet with nuttiness. The body is dry and chalky, on the light side and winds up with a nice long malty finish. This is a very nice representation of a not so common.
